Transaction 17ad65e24a0f0849a64971f31338abe4cc328dd2260e457318035399857ae386

1 Input
2 Outputs
  • 17ad65e24a0f0849a64971f31338abe4cc328dd2260e457318035399857ae386:0
  • value  15117470
    address  3QoJgmrjFHED9V1JxbL4fpuq3NFMm2nH1v
  • 17ad65e24a0f0849a64971f31338abe4cc328dd2260e457318035399857ae386:1
  • value  7879872
    address  1JKWa7gdasodEBeJoHTSucQWv7EjRwxCno